Transaction cd61c053d101c7a4032970eb936c8cab976eb0ad9e7822e2eb25e4c4eb7875b0

1 Input
2 Outputs
  • cd61c053d101c7a4032970eb936c8cab976eb0ad9e7822e2eb25e4c4eb7875b0:0
  • value  536432
    address  3QNFU8GwVAdJDYEfyMcoAJDd6VV5BSnaq7
  • cd61c053d101c7a4032970eb936c8cab976eb0ad9e7822e2eb25e4c4eb7875b0:1
  • value  265652
    address  33t6djfcmkfFLoMtvR4YK81SbdpMFgkK3G